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
000 683074082 01773382 83
54690183 72 779915262
54690183 72 779915262
6976 08961135 9990043
All about undefined
Interested in learning more?
54690183 72 779915262
6976 08961135 9990043
See more
9751993051 5094 75923102
45855235 5987677941 106080
See more
740 54945851 295896824
43189089847 2979 35719 1038 309
See more